Weddin ' Announcement
GERRITS AND HOSTE
Cherry Gerrits and Paul Hoste were united in marriage on
June 3 at Northside United Church in Seaforth. Cherry is the
daughter of Bill and Amy Gerrits of Clinton. Paul is the son
of Herman and Chris Hoste of Seaforth. The matron of
honor was Darlene Vantyghem, friend of the bride. and the
bridesmaids were Crystal Garrett, Marlene Pino, Sandra
Melady, Angela Murray and Pat Postma, all friends of the
bride. The best man was Dave Vantyghem, friend of the
groom and groomsmen were Piet Hoste, brother of the
groom. Herman and Kevin Gerrits, brothers of the bride, and
Andrew Plunkett and Scott Colwell, both friends of the
groom. The flowergirl was Emily Donaldson, niece of the
groom. The ringbearer was Ian Donaldson, nephew of the
groom. The couple now resides outside of Seaforth.

Residents enjoy geese
during Stratford, outing
Seaforth Manor Nursing Home
Residents enjoyed seeing all
the community visitors at
our Clinton Legion Pipe
Band concert this past
month. A lovely fall evening
was enhanced by the sights
and sounds of the drums and
the pipes. Hot apple cider
was served to ward off any
evening chills, and all agreed
that this is one of our
favourite community events.
An outing to Stratford for
our fall colour tour was
enjoyed. A delicious lunch
was enjoyed down by the
river. The swans and the
r geese nearby made this a
very picturesque day.
We were fortunate to have
many musical entertainers in
during the past month. The
Zurich Connection, Carol
Carter, Carol Lebeau and
Bill Pepper, Paul the Fiddler
' and Marie Flynn and The
Huron Strings all provided
toe -tapping music to delight
our residents.
A very special afternoon
was held by the family of
Len Strong to celebrate his
87th birthday. Members of
the Strong family were
joined by the Barbershop
Quartet, "Audibly
Awesome" to entertain all of
our residents for a wonderful
program.
Members of Anne Nolan's
family also held a special
celebration in honour of her
75th birthday.
Our Western Days theme
for the month had everyone
enjoying our final barbecue
of the season. a county fair
video, the movie, "Babe, Pig
in the City," and our western
dance with everyone
sporting cowboy hats.
We enjoyed seeing
everyone who stopped by
our booth at the Seafortti Fall
Fair. ,
Our coffee break.
fundraiser for the
Alzheimers Society was
enjoyed by all who attended.
We were also delighted to
have the youth from the
"Christ in Others Retreat"
group visit us for an
afternoon as part of their
weekend activities.
Providing our worship
services for September were
Rev. Nic Vandermey, Bob
Hulley, Rev. Rob Hiscox,
Rev. Dino Salvador and Rev.
Sheila Macgregor. We look
forward once again to
hosting the ministerial
meetings for our area clergy.
Welcome to the members
of the grief,recovery group
who have begun a new
session of weekly meetings
as well as the cancer support
group who hold their
monthly meetings here at our
facility.
If you know of any group
or community organization,
looking for a place to meet,
please call Cheryl Phillips at
527-0030.
We would like to invite
everyone to attend our
Farewell Tea for Lynne
Lawson on Tuesday, Oct. 17
from 2-4 p.m. in our first
floor living room. Lynne has
accepted a position closer to
her home of Guelph.
